Engineered for efficiency, RED-E-DUCT consists of UL rated PVC conduits encased in high strength, thermal efficient concrete. RED-E-DUCT’s low thermal resistivity adds peace of mind by reducing the risk of premature cable failure due to inadequate backfills, poor installation practices and high thermal temperatures.
